    Default Truman lake map... / fishing report


    I see places like "Jackson" or "Pretty Bob" mentioned, but as a relative newby to crappie fishing and Truman lake I have no idea where these places are. I've looked at maps of the lake but still don't see these places listed.

    My question - is there a map that shows these places by this name? If so where can I get it?

    Fishing report- fished Saturday and Sunday. Both days we put in at Bucksaw before sun up left at noon and mostly fished one cove. It's the first big cove on the left if you come out of Bucksaw and hang a right. Basically due west of the marina if your headed up toward highway U bridge (see if I had a map I could possibly give you a name here). Anyway we kept 17 Saturday and 28 Sunday between the two of us. We were pitching jigs at the bank under a cork about 16" down. Our best luck was back in the cove where it turns south and there's a rock face. We picked up about 10, 11-13 inch fish in a span of about 100 yards both days. Black and chartreuse, purple and chartreuse, or dark green and chartreuse were the ticket. I was using a plain lead head jig with a sickle hook and my backseat was using a roadrunner jig head.

    Kept all males. Big fish was a 14" female (only female we caught all weekend) that I took a pic with and put back in the water.

    Look up into where the actual creek is. I know Pretty Bob is on the map because I was in that area this past weekend. I used the regular corps map that is given away in parks, stores, etc. I checked and Jackson is on the Fishing Hotspots map for that section (North Map). The Hotspots map is good for the beginning Truman fisherman. The Hotspots map are sold in most tackle stores and Walmarts. They are about $11 a piece and you will need North and South sections for Truman.
